说明:用 spring 自身提供的 stopWatch API
@Test public void test01() throws InterruptedException { StopWatch watch = new StopWatch(); watch.start("任务一"); Thread.sleep(3000); watch.stop(); System.out.println("任务名称:" + watch.getLastTaskName() + ",耗时:" + watch.getLastTaskTimeMillis()); watch.start("任务二"); Thread.sleep(1000); watch.stop(); System.out.println("任务名称:" + watch.getLastTaskName() + ",耗时:" + watch.getLastTaskTimeMillis());
// 统计 System.out.println(watch.prettyPrint()); }
